> Instead of VMs, have you considered docker containers? I do web
> development (drupal), and am migrating my team off our vagrant
> development setups to docker and getting huge returns on fast startup
> times and OS overhead savings. On my laptop I could generally run 4
> development VMs (LAMP with bonus tools and xdebugging/profiling stuffs)
> before things got sluggish. I've run 10 docker stacks (all very
> similar) without any real pressure on the cpu or memory.
